Our dogs travel legally via Traces, which is the database system used to monitor all animal transportation within the EU. The dogs travel neutered (if old enough), vaccinated, microchipped, and dewormed, and have an EU passport. Additionally, for dogs over 12 months of age, a quick test is done before travel to check for Mediterranean diseases such as Lyme disease, Anaplasmosis, Ehrlichiosis, Heartworm, and Leishmaniasis. Senior dogs settle in faster than younger ones. They want a soft bed, predictable meals, and short, sniff-heavy walks rather than runs. Many senior rescues bond deeply within weeks because they understand exactly how good a stable home is. Expect occasional vet visits for joint or dental care.

🇩🇪Adopting from Germany

German rescues typically require an in-person home visit (Vorkontrolle) or detailed video home check before approving adoption. Animals leave the shelter sterilized, microchipped, and with a valid EU pet passport. Adoption fees usually fall between €250 and €450, covering veterinary preparation.

Can I adopt Viccy if I live in another country?
Yes, in most cases. Rescues across Europe routinely place animals abroad — Seelen für Seelchen e.V. will tell you what they need (EU pet passport, rabies titer, transport coordination) and whether they handle transport themselves or refer you to a partner. Plan for an extra €100–€350 in transport costs depending on distance.
